What Is EEG Sleep Monitoring and Why Does It Matter?

EEG sleep monitoring captures the tiny electrical impulses your neurons generate as they communicate during sleep. Unlike traditional wearables that rely on heart rate variability or wrist movement as proxies for sleep stages, EEG reads the source code directly from your brain. This matters because misclassifying wakefulness as light sleep (or vice versa) can skew your sleep data by 30-40%, leading to misguided optimization efforts.

The technology works through dry electrodes embedded in the mask’s fabric that press gently against your forehead and temples. These sensors detect microvolt-level signals representing different frequency bands: delta waves (0.5-4 Hz) dominate deep sleep, theta waves (4-8 Hz) mark the transition to lighter stages, and rapid beta activity (12-30 Hz) indicates wakefulness or REM sleep when combined with eye movement patterns.

How EEG Differs From Other Sleep Tracking Methods

Accelerometer-based trackers infer sleep from stillness, but they can’t distinguish between lying motionless awake and actual sleep. Photoplethysmography (PPG) sensors measure blood flow changes, which correlate with sleep stages but lag behind neural activity by 60-90 seconds. EEG eliminates this guesswork by capturing the brain’s real-time electrical signature, providing what sleep researchers call “ground truth” data. In 2026 models, multi-modal fusion—combining EEG with PPG, temperature, and movement sensors—creates redundancy that filters out artifacts and boosts accuracy to 85-90% concordance with polysomnography.

The Evolution of Smart Eye Masks: From Simple Light Blocking to Brain Wave Analysis

The journey began with basic contoured masks that improved comfort but offered zero insights. The first “smart” iterations added simple vibration alarms and basic PPG sensors, but they still operated at the periphery of true sleep science. The breakthrough came when manufacturers solved the “dry electrode problem”—creating conductive fabrics that maintained stable skin contact without the conductive gels used in medical settings.

The Integration Challenge

Engineering a consumer-friendly EEG eye mask meant solving three paradoxes: maintaining signal quality while ensuring comfort, delivering continuous power without bulk, and processing massive data streams on-device without overheating. 2026 models achieve this through flexible printed circuit boards that conform to facial contours, low-power ARM processors that run machine learning algorithms locally, and graphene-enhanced battery cells that charge in under an hour while lasting three nights. The result is a device that weighs under 100 grams yet captures 1,000 data points per second from multiple cortical regions.

Understanding Sleep Metrics: What Your EEG Eye Mask Measures

Your nightly output includes a hypnogram visualizing sleep stages across time, but the real insights lie in derived metrics. Sleep latency measures the transition from wakefulness (beta waves) to light sleep (theta dominance). Sleep efficiency calculates the ratio of total sleep time to time in bed, with elite sleepers achieving 85%+. REM density quantifies the frequency of rapid eye movements per REM period, correlating with emotional processing and memory consolidation.

Decoding Your Sleep Architecture

Look beyond simple percentages. A healthy adult sleep cycle spans 90-110 minutes, with deep sleep concentrated in the first third of the night and REM periods lengthening toward morning. Your mask should detect sleep spindles (12-14 Hz bursts) and K-complexes—hallmarks of stable sleep that protect against awakenings. Fragmentation index reveals how often you transition between stages, with scores above 20 per hour indicating significant sleep disruption. The most advanced 2026 models now track inter-hemispheric asymmetry, which can signal stress or neurological issues when one hemisphere shows markedly different activity.

The Role of AI and Machine Learning in Sleep Optimization

Raw EEG data is meaningless without interpretation. Modern devices employ convolutional neural networks trained on millions of hours of polysomnography data to classify sleep stages in real-time. These models don’t just label epochs; they predict sleep quality outcomes based on patterns invisible to human scorers—like micro-architectural markers of pre-insomnia or early signs of sleep apnea.

The real magic happens in longitudinal analysis. After 30 nights, AI algorithms establish your personal sleep baseline, then detect deviations that correlate with lifestyle factors. Did your deep sleep drop 15% after that late workout? Did REM latency shorten when you started magnesium supplementation? The system learns which interventions work for your unique neurophysiology, moving beyond generic advice to hyper-personalized protocols. Some platforms now integrate with your calendar, correlating sleep metrics with work stress or travel schedules to preemptively adjust your bedtime routine.

Potential Drawbacks and Limitations to Consider

No technology is perfect. The first week involves a significant adjustment period—many users report sleep disturbances as they adapt to the mask’s presence and the subconscious awareness of being monitored. Dry electrodes, while convenient, are more susceptible to motion artifacts than clinical gel-based systems, meaning restless sleepers may see 10-15% of their data flagged as unreliable.

Who Should Avoid EEG Sleep Masks?

Individuals with severe claustrophobia or tactile sensory issues may find the constant pressure intolerable. Those with certain skin conditions like eczema or psoriasis should consult dermatologists, as even hypoallergenic materials can trigger flare-ups. Critically, these devices are wellness tools, not diagnostic instruments. If you suspect sleep apnea, narcolepsy, or other disorders, pursue a formal sleep study—consumer EEG can suggest issues but cannot replace clinical diagnosis.

How to Integrate EEG Sleep Masks Into Your Bedtime Routine

Don’t just strap it on and hope for the best. Start with baseline collection: wear the mask for seven nights without changing any variables to understand your natural patterns. Then introduce one intervention at a time—melatonin, blue light blocking, temperature changes—and measure its impact over two weeks. Keep a sleep diary correlating subjective feel with objective metrics; this trains you to trust the data while honoring your body’s signals.

Use the smart alarm feature strategically. Set your wake-up window to end at your desired time, letting the mask rouse you during optimal sleep stages. On weekends, disable the alarm to measure your natural circadian rhythm—your “sleep need” debt may be larger than you think. Export your data monthly to track trends; look for seasonal variations or correlations with life stressors that the app’s AI might miss.
